Theoretical considerations are all fine and dandy, and even if you spent time with the serial offenders explaining the potential risks they run, I suspect it would only have limited effect on them, for a limited time, before they would revert to type.
It is the new recruits in the RHS who I feel sorry for. I wonder if they know just what they are letting themselves in for?

What would possibly concentrate the mind would be robust SMS management and spelling out in unequivocal terms the employment sanctions the company would impose when unsafe practices took place.
Just how you integrate this into ‘Cultural’ considerations is something else, together with the role of the Regulator?

EASA has made it clear to PIA what is expected of them before the EU airspace ban is lifted.
